Overview of Dubai Butterfly Garden
Dubai Butterfly Garden is renowned as the world’s largest indoor butterfly garden with more than 15,000 butterflies belonging to more than 50 species. It is situated in Dubailand district, Al Barsha South 3, and offers an opportunity to explore a vibrant, natural habitat filled with multicolored flowers and plants.
Key Attractions
Climate-Controlled Domes: The garden contains ten specially designed, climate-controlled domes that provide the perfect environment for the butterflies. The temperature is maintained at a warm 24°C, which is a pleasant visit for both humans and butterflies.

- Koi Pond: Situated in Dome 2, the Koi pond is home to multicolored koi fish and is a serene area to sit and photograph.
- Educational Area: This area features the fascinating butterfly life cycle, from caterpillar to winged adult.
- Kids Cinema: A small cinema where children can view educational butterfly movies, giving a relaxing interlude during the visit.

Practical Information
- Opening Hours: It remains open from 9 AM to 6 PM every day.
- Ticket Price: Around AED 55 for adults and kids above 3 years.
- Best Time to Visit: Afternoon visits are advised, particularly between the cooler months of November to March.
- Accessibility for All: The garden is handicapped-friendly and provides carts for disabled visitors.
